Why Romania's Energy Storage Market Is Heating Up

Romania has seen a 47% increase in renewable energy capacity since 2020, creating urgent demand for storage systems. The average price range for industrial-scale energy storage machines currently stands between €400/kWh to €800/kWh, depending on technology and configuration.

Key Price Drivers in 2024

  • Battery chemistry: Lithium-ion dominates with 68% market share
  • System capacity: 100 kWh units average €62,000 vs. 1 MWh at €550,000
  • Government subsidies: Up to 30% cost reduction through NRRP grants

TechnologyPrice Range (€/kWh)Lifespan
Lithium-Ion420-72010-15 years
Flow Batteries580-89020+ years
Lead-Acid240-3805-8 years

Smart Buying Strategies

Don't just compare sticker prices – consider these hidden factors:

  • Cycling capacity: How often can the system charge/discharge?
  • Temperature tolerance: -20°C to 50°C systems cost 12-15% more
  • Warranty terms: Look for >10-year coverage on capacity retention

Future Price Projections

Industry analysts predict 8-12% annual price declines through 2027 as local manufacturing expands. However, grid connection fees (currently €15-€25/kW) may offset some savings.

FAQ: Romania Energy Storage Costs

Q: What's the payback period for a 500 kWh system? A: Typically 5-8 years with daily cycling under current energy prices.

Q: Are second-life batteries worth considering? A: Yes – prices start at €180/kWh but verify cycle life certifications.
